Evaluating Different Franchise Opportunities

The most efficient way for any individual to make money would be to leverage his efforts through other people. Operating a business is an excellent way to generate hefty streams of income, as such entities efficiently utilize the law of leverage.

But considering how difficult the task of building any commercial enterprise to compete with other businesses is, franchise opportunities may perhaps be the only way for any businessman to last in any overly competitive environment.

Despite the sizeable advantage these franchised businesses can offer its owners, the process of selecting one can be quite daunting. To ensure a suitable match is found, the first step a future franchisee needs to take is to evaluate his own personal preferences.

The success of a business is largely dependent on its owner’s passion for the trade it engages – people obsessed over vehicles are likely to thrive within the automobile industry, while folks naturally inclined towards helping other individuals would be better off running healthcare franchises.

Another factor to contemplate over is the lifestyle change operating such a franchise will render, as some commercial establishments will require the owner’s presence more than others, while others may be more laidback.

Return on interest is definitely something that an individual should look into – a business that can make money in consistently large amounts would obviously be preferred over one that doesn’t.

After a future franchisee assesses himself, the next step is to carefully evaluate the different franchise opportunities which matches his criteria. Moreover, analyzing the franchisor infrastructure is crucial, as this is usually a massive determining factor for the success of all franchisees.

While assessing the franchisor system, keep in mind that the enormous organization seen today started off as a singular commercial establishment. Choosing to expand operations and generate larger streams of automated income through franchising will require skills beyond that possessed by average entrepreneurs.

Complying with legal requirements, recording operational approaches, creating marketing strategies, developing training systems, plus handling all other aspects of a business is tough, and even harder to teach to hundreds or thousands of others.

Franchise opportunities should have a tested and proven system which can easily be taught to interested franchisees. When adopted, this system will either make money for recruits, or gradually lead them to financial failure. So considering its importance, cautiously gauging their system, as well as verifying how well it works for current franchisees, is absolutely necessary for any anticipative businessman.

Searching For Franchise Opportunities At Expositions

People who choose to buy a business, instead of going through the financially unhealthy way of learning how to start one that’ll last, are doing themselves huge favors. Building a successful commercial establishment from the ground up can be extremely difficult, especially since statistics show that most ventures fail within their first year of operation.

Franchise opportunities make things even easier, and statistically safer, for hopeful entrepreneurs to run establishments that can compete and make money. Coming across these types of businesses isn’t difficult, as they’re advertised practically everywhere.

That being said, franchise expositions are great places to find potential businesses to run. Different commercial brands are advertised at such events, and there are salesmen who’ll explain the advantages that come with each brand.

However, it’s important to keep in mind that the main purpose of salesmen is to sell their product, so many of these professionals will tend to be aggressive. There are times where folks fall victim to sweet sales pitches, and end up investing significant amounts of cash to buy a business they don’t like, or doesn’t make money.

To avoid this from happening, interested franchisees should always do ample research on different franchise opportunities before going to any exposition. This’ll give them a rough idea on what kinds of businesses they’d be interested in running, the amount of capital they’ll need to get started, and how competitive the industry is.

In addition, future entrepreneurs should also assess their current skillsets, and decide whether or not it’s suitable for competing within a particular industry. Moreover, they should have passion for the type of business they intend to run – these folks have to ensure they’ll still be happy operating within the same industry ten to twenty years from now.

Soon-to-be franchisees should also verify earning reports shown by franchisors – it’s easy for anyone to say they net $20,000 a month, and make verbal explanations to back up their claims. FTC requires franchisors to substantiate such statements through official written reports, so asking for these documents is highly recommended.

Once an individual has finally made up his mind to buy a business which operates under a certain industry, comparison shopping with five or more franchisors is recommended. The franchise opportunities offered by franchisors will be under different terms and conditions, and some have greater potential to make more than others. That being said, carefully researching about the backgrounds of each franchisor to root out the best one is strongly advised.

The Big Salad Franchise

When fast food chains first came out decades ago, they took the entire world by storm with the opening of thousands of franchises around the globe. Back then, they were one of the most profitable businesses amongst all industries, and have generated massive streams of income for franchisees.

While their branches continue to rake in money, it pales in comparison to what they did back in the day when consumers were kept in the dark regarding health risks inherent to their products. Now that practically everyone on the planet is aware of the dangers associated with eating burgers, fries and pizza, the demand for restaurants offering healthier alternatives is growing exponentially.

The Big Salad is one franchise that’s capitalizing on this massive opportunity to make money from millions of individuals looking to eat healthier. This type of business couldn’t have been established at a better time, since there are only a limited number of commercial diners selling these vegetables and other healthy edibles.

Current establishments which “specialize” in selling non-meat products observe low-standards when it comes to service and product quality. John A. Bornoty, the founder of this franchise, constantly complained how other businesses were inconsistent with maintaining fresh veggies, as well as the health hazards posed by the germ invested environments they kept.

Bornoty decided to capitalize on their sloppiness, as well as the demand of folks for better, healthier menus, by creating The Big Salad – a premier restaurant serving the freshest, veggie-based meals in the country. He also ensured that strict cleanliness standards were adopted, with dedicated salad chefs creating each item on the menu according to each customer’s likings.

Aside from the fact that all meals are packed with nutritional value, and are served in an incomparably clean setting, the sheer diversity of possible meal combinations makes the idea of eating at this establishment even better.

Consumers are free to choose from over thirty dressing types, twenty-eight vegetables toppings, eight dry toppings, as well as eight meat and seafood toppings. This gives customers over 17 million custom combinations to order from the establishment’s highly-qualified salad chefs.

Becoming a franchisee of The Big Salad is open to those with or without experience in the industry, as the franchisors have developed and perfected a system which caters for everyone. Total investment needed to shoulder franchise fees, as well as start-up capital, is reasonably priced somewhere in between $202,550 to $385,220 at the most.

Unlike other franchisors, the operational manual included shows a simplified, step-by-step process on everything a franchisee will need to know for running his outlet, including the following: daily check list for opening and closing, procedures for hiring/training employees, employee handbook plus guidelines, food rotation procedures, food preparations plus setup, payroll procedures, and more.

Despite its recent foundation date back in 2008, franchisors were able to develop a system that allows franchise owners to monitor, and even run, the entire business from virtually any location. In the event something doesn’t go according to plan, members of the corporate office will immediately render support whenever necessary.

The Power of Excellent Customer Service

Much like the admiration that ordinary individuals have for olympic athletes, retailing businesses and other companies from outside the US with excellent customer service have also earned a lot of admiration and respect after being highlighted at the recent international franchisees gathering during Crestcom International’s yearly convention.  Hal Krause founded Crestcom 25 years ago with a mission to provide the world with modern management training.  Franchisees conduct Crestcom’s video-based workshops on management skills in 25 languages over 50 countries.

Excellent Customer Service

During the convention, Crestcom shared a number of admirable customer service from around the world.  One such experience happened to Joerg Hasenclever, an international franchisee while he was staying at Vila Vita Rosepark Hotel in Germany for the training program on management skills.  Hasenclever was provided an MP3 player with his favorite music when he checked-in.  His car was also washed and cleaned when the seminar ended.

International franchisee Joachim Schulz also experienced a one-of-a-kind customer service when he went to pick up his brand-new Lexus RX.  The car came with a tiny ladder, which the salesperson explained was for Schulz’s elderly dog who can no longer jump up into the car.

Another franchisee of Crestcom, Gunter Lonneman had a remarkable experience when he had his kitchen remodeled.  The company not only did a great job but also took the service to a higher level.  The company sent two ladies to cook for the family and clean the kitchen after.  Unlike most retailing businesses, this particular kitchen retailer really spoils its clients.

The Kuala Lumpur-based AirAsia is another company that knows how to providefirst-rate customer service.  It was named as the World’s No.1 Low-Cost Airline during the World Airline Award 2012, its third award in a row.

Aside from its strict on-time departure and low fares, AirAsia operates using modern aircraft complete with the latest entertainment systems for its customers.  The company also offers outstanding web-based system on travel information.  For questions or flight bookings, customers can simply log on to its website and chat with its online avatar who is capable of talking in several languages.

Much is to be learned from these companies when it comes to their quality products and superb customer service.  Individuals who have plans of franchising a business and looking for a franchise for sale should study how these companies operate.  Just like these companies, a franchise for sale must also be able to offer successful products and exceptional customer service.

Improve Customer Loyalty through NPS

If you want to know how to start a business and make money the right way, then understanding customer loyalty is essential.  The opinion of the customer is the most important factor that determines the decline or success of a franchise.  In general, franchisors who appreciate and understand the importance of loyalty from customers are able to make money and flourish in their business.

Franchise organizations that provide quality customer service and generate recommendations from customers get bigger return.  How a franchise organization delivers service to its customers greatly affects the company’s reputation, renewals, repurchase, and referrals.  Both the competitive market and today’s online word-of-mouth promotion intensifies the effect of customer loyalty on a franchise system’s financial performance.

The widely adopted NPS or Net Promoter Score is the basis of ranking customer loyalty at present.  Franchisors however must be able to understand and analyze their customer feedbacks and utilize them to improve the effectiveness of their organization instead of just knowing the number.

The franchise system has intricate structures and franchise locations are endless, making it difficult to address, understand, and measure feedback on customer loyalty.  But software approaches capable of delivering NPS are very useful as such software can turn the packaged NPS solutions commodity into a full system that can provide actions and insights to achieve success.

Promoters are individuals who recommend services and products either online or in person.  They are able to create stronger value not only on their purchase behavior but on their effect to others as well.  While those who have negative opinions are detractors that need to be addressed immediately as problems arise.  Closing the distance with the detractors will not only lessen negative business impression but fast attention given to them can also promote loyalty and turn detractors into promoters.  Results are attained by mobilizing promoters and recovering detractors, enabling franchisors to increase profits.

Segment reporting and alert management enable franchises to extend a specific action to enhance franchise operations.  NPS Go for example, provides routing alerts and insights to the right people in the franchise organization, which helps improve customer experience, thus achieving a good investment return.

Home page reports and dashboards that are role-based can also aid employees in supervising and addressing loyalty of customer by unit.  This allows franchises to implement the best strategies to enhance customer experience.
